Real-World Case Studies: Lessons Learned

Let's take a look at a real-world case study to illustrate the importance of configuring firewalls and intrusion detection systems. In 2017, Equifax, one of the largest credit reporting agencies, suffered a massive data breach that exposed sensitive information of over 147 million people. The breach was caused by a vulnerability in the Apache Struts open-source software, which was not properly patched. An intrusion detection system could have detected the suspicious traffic and alerted the security team, potentially preventing the breach.

Industry-Relevant Tools and Technologies

The Undergraduate Certificate in Configuring Firewalls and Intrusion Detection Systems for Secure Networks covers industry-relevant tools and technologies, such as:

  • Firewalls: Cisco ASA, Juniper SRX, and Check Point

  • Intrusion detection systems: Snort, Suricata, and OSSEC

  • Network protocols: TCP/IP, DNS, and DHCP

Students learn how to configure and manage these tools and technologies, making them proficient in the latest security technologies.
